Stevia, a non-nutritive sweetener derived from the leaves of the Stevia rebaudiana plant, is a popular sugar substitute for those looking to reduce their calorie and sugar intake. However, its growing popularity has been accompanied by questions regarding its safety. The key to understanding the potential harm lies in distinguishing between the highly purified stevia extracts approved by regulatory bodies and the less-refined, crude forms of the plant.

The Crucial Distinction: Pure Extract vs. Whole Leaf

Not all stevia products are created equal. The US Food and Drug Administration (FDA) has given 'Generally Recognized as Safe' (GRAS) status only to highly purified steviol glycoside extracts, which are at least 95% pure. The FDA does not permit whole stevia leaves or crude stevia extracts to be marketed as sweeteners due to a lack of toxicological information. Therefore, consumers must understand the specific type of stevia they are purchasing.

  • Highly Purified Stevia Extract: The form considered safe by regulatory bodies worldwide, including the FDA and the Joint Food and Agriculture Organization/World Health Organization Expert Committee on Food Additives (JECFA). This is the ingredient found in most popular stevia-based tabletop sweeteners (e.g., Truvia, Pure Via).
  • Whole Stevia Leaf and Crude Extracts: These less processed forms are not approved for use in food products by the FDA. They are sold as dietary supplements, but there is insufficient research on their safety profile, which is why consumers should be cautious.

Potential Side Effects and Concerns

While high-purity stevia is deemed safe for most, some potential side effects and health considerations are worth noting.

Digestive Issues from Additives

One of the most common reasons for adverse digestive reactions to stevia products isn't the stevia itself, but the other ingredients. Many commercial stevia blends contain sugar alcohols (like erythritol) or other fillers to add bulk and counteract the extract's bitter aftertaste. These additives can cause digestive symptoms such as:

  • Bloating
  • Nausea
  • Cramping
  • Diarrhea

These effects are dose-dependent, meaning they are more likely to occur with higher intake.

Drug Interactions and Medical Conditions

Stevia's ability to lower blood sugar and blood pressure is beneficial for some but requires caution for others.

  • Diabetes Medications: If you take medication to manage diabetes, combining it with stevia might cause your blood sugar levels to drop too low.
  • Hypertension Medications: Stevia may also lower blood pressure, and combining it with antihypertensive drugs could cause blood pressure to fall too low.
  • Lithium: Stevia has diuretic effects, which can increase the speed at which the body expels water and electrolytes. This could potentially affect how the body removes lithium, possibly causing serious side effects.

Impact on Gut Microbiome

Research on stevia's effects on gut health is mixed and ongoing. Some animal and in vitro studies have shown a potential for stevia to disrupt the gut's microbial balance, while more recent human studies are less conclusive. While the evidence is conflicting, some individuals with sensitive digestive systems or existing gut issues may experience different reactions.

Hormone Disruption Research

Some research has explored the possibility that steviol glycosides could interfere with hormone production due to their similar molecular structure to steroids. An older 2016 study found that human sperm cells exposed to steviol showed an increase in progesterone production. However, more research on humans is needed to draw any solid conclusions, and current evidence does not suggest stevia acts as an endocrine disruptor in humans at typical consumption levels.

How to Use Stevia Safely

Following these guidelines can help you enjoy stevia while minimizing potential risks:

  • Read Labels Carefully: Always check the ingredients list. Opt for products that contain only high-purity stevia extract and avoid blends with added sugar alcohols if you are sensitive to them.
  • Use in Moderation: As with any food product, moderation is key. Consuming excessive amounts, even of pure stevia, is not recommended. The Acceptable Daily Intake (ADI) is set high enough that most people won't exceed it under normal circumstances.
  • Consult a Healthcare Provider: If you are on medication for diabetes, high blood pressure, or are pregnant or breastfeeding, speak with a doctor before adding stevia to your diet.
  • Start Small: Introduce stevia gradually to monitor your body's reaction, especially if you have a sensitive digestive system. If you experience negative effects like bloating or nausea, it may be the result of a filler ingredient.

Stevia vs. Other Sweeteners: Potential Pitfalls

This comparison table highlights key differences between purified stevia extract, sugar, and common sugar alcohols often found in stevia blends.

Feature Purified Stevia Extract Table Sugar (Sucrose) Sugar Alcohols (e.g., Erythritol)
Calorie Count Zero calories Approx. 16 calories per tsp Significantly fewer calories than sugar
Glycemic Impact Zero glycemic index (no blood sugar impact) High (raises blood sugar) Low (less effect on blood sugar)
FDA Status GRAS (Generally Recognized As Safe) Approved for human consumption Approved for use as a food additive
Common Side Effects Mild bitterness at high concentration Weight gain, dental issues Gastrointestinal distress (bloating, gas)
Source Plant-based (leaves of Stevia rebaudiana) Plant-based (sugar cane, beets) Occurs naturally in some fruits, also manufactured

Conclusion: Moderation and Awareness Are Key

Is there anything harmful in stevia? For most people, when consumed in moderation and in its highly purified form, stevia is a safe alternative to sugar, offering benefits like zero calories and no blood sugar impact. The primary risks are associated with the less-regulated crude leaf forms, additives (especially sugar alcohols) in commercial blends that can cause digestive issues, and potential drug interactions for those with pre-existing conditions like diabetes or high blood pressure. By choosing high-purity extracts and being mindful of other ingredients, consumers can safely enjoy the sweet benefits of stevia. Always consult a healthcare professional with any specific concerns, particularly regarding drug interactions.
